Swiatek loving life in her Doha comfort zone

Iga Swiatek notched up a 10th straight win at the WTA Qatar Open on Wednesday, moving into the quarter-finals over 14th seed Ekaterina Alexandrova 6-1, 6-4.

The world No. 1 winner is defending her title and has won the Gulf tournament twice; her latest victory took 91 minutes.

Swiatek polished her record at the tournament to a solid 11-1 with her only losing coming four years ago to Svetlana Kuznetsova; she has not lost a set here in two years..

The winner had to work for victory and needed five match points in the final game to get over the line and into the last eight after saving all eight break points she faced..
